A rare case of spontaneous resolution of eosinophilic ascites in a patient with primary eosinophilic gastroenteritis. 原发性嗜酸性胃肠炎患者嗜酸性腹水自发性消退的罕见病例。
Chang Gung medical journal Pub Date : 2012-07-01 DOI: 10.4103/2319-4170.106134
Wei-Hsuan Liao, Kuo-Liang Wei, Po-Yen-Lin, Cheng-Shyong Wu
{"title":"A rare case of spontaneous resolution of eosinophilic ascites in a patient with primary eosinophilic gastroenteritis.","authors":"Wei-Hsuan Liao,&nbsp;Kuo-Liang Wei,&nbsp;Po-Yen-Lin,&nbsp;Cheng-Shyong Wu","doi":"10.4103/2319-4170.106134","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.4103/2319-4170.106134","url":null,"abstract":"<p><p>Eosinophilic gastroenteritis is a rare gastrointestinal disorder characterized by nonspecific gastrointestinal symptoms, peripheral eosinophilia, and eosinophilic infiltration of the intestinal wall. The disorder is classified into mucosal, muscular, and subserosal types, depending on the depth of eosinophilic infiltration within the gastrointestinal wall, and the clinical picture varies accordingly. Subserosal disease, which is complicated by ascites, usually results in the most severe clinical form of eosinophilic gastroenteritis and mandates early corticosteroid therapy. In such cases, a favorable outcome can be achieved after a short course of corticosteroids. We present a rare case in a 43 year-old man in whom eosinophilic gastroenteritis spontaneously resolved without any medical treatment. High-fat diet aggravates islet beta-cell toxicity in mice treated with clozapine. 高脂肪饮食加重氯氮平治疗小鼠胰岛β细胞毒性。
Chang Gung medical journal Pub Date : 2012-07-01 DOI: 10.4103/2319-4170.106139
Chung-Huei Huang, Shin-Huei Fu, Samuel Hsu, Yu-Yao Huang, Szu-Tah Chen, Brend Ray-Sea Hsu
{"title":"High-fat diet aggravates islet beta-cell toxicity in mice treated with clozapine.","authors":"Chung-Huei Huang,&nbsp;Shin-Huei Fu,&nbsp;Samuel Hsu,&nbsp;Yu-Yao Huang,&nbsp;Szu-Tah Chen,&nbsp;Brend Ray-Sea Hsu","doi":"10.4103/2319-4170.106139","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.4103/2319-4170.106139","url":null,"abstract":"<p><strong>Background: </strong>Clozapine, an atypical antipsychotic drug, induces derangements in glucose homeostasis in certain patients. This study investigated the mechanisms of clozapine-induced beta-cell toxicity.</p><p><strong>Methods: </strong>Fifty-two healthy C57BL/6 male mice were randomized into 4 groups to study the effects of clozapine (group C, D) and a high-fat diet (group B, D). Three mice from each group were randomly selected to determine the amount of food intake on days 8-10, and their pancreases were removed for histological examination on day 11. The remaining 10 mice in each group were sacrificed at the 8th week to measure pancreatic insulin content (PIC).</p><p><strong>Results: </strong>Mice given clozapine for 8 weeks demonstrated trends of lower PIC. The histological examination of the pancreases retrieved on day 11 already revealed apoptotic changes and suppression of cell proliferation. Although mice fed high-fat chow gained weight, mice given both clozapine and a high-fat diet showed less weight gain and more severe histological deterioration, and had the lowest PIC levels of the 4 groups.</p><p><strong>Conclusion: </strong>Pancreatic beta-cell apoptosis, suppression of cell proliferation, and trends of reduction in pancreatic insulin content were observed in mice taking clozapine. Computed tomography-based navigation-assisted pedicle screw insertion for thoracic and lumbar spine fractures. 基于计算机断层扫描的导航辅助椎弓根螺钉置入治疗胸腰椎骨折。
Chang Gung medical journal Pub Date : 2012-07-01 DOI: 10.4103/2319-4170.106137
Chih-Yun Fan Chiang, Tsung-Ting Tsai, Lih-Huei Chen, Po-Liang Lai, Tsai-Sheng Fu, Chi-Chien Niu, Wen-Jer Chen
{"title":"Computed tomography-based navigation-assisted pedicle screw insertion for thoracic and lumbar spine fractures.","authors":"Chih-Yun Fan Chiang,&nbsp;Tsung-Ting Tsai,&nbsp;Lih-Huei Chen,&nbsp;Po-Liang Lai,&nbsp;Tsai-Sheng Fu,&nbsp;Chi-Chien Niu,&nbsp;Wen-Jer Chen","doi":"10.4103/2319-4170.106137","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.4103/2319-4170.106137","url":null,"abstract":"BACKGROUND\u0000Incorrect placement of pedicle screws may lead to neurovascular injury, so the position is important for the reduction of spinal fractures. CT-based image-guided surgery has been promoted as a means to theoretically improve the accuracy of pedicle screw placement. Patients who underwent CT-based navigation-assisted pedicle screw fixation for thoracic or lumbar fractures were reviewed to evaluate the accuracy of pedicle screw placement for spinal fracture cases.\u0000\u0000\u0000METHODS\u0000A computed tomographic (CT)-based image-guided system (BrainLAB) was used for pedicle screw insertion in 14 patients with thoracic or lumbar spine fractures. The accuracy of pedicle screw placement was analyzed by the preoperative and postoperative Cobb's angle and sagittal screw angle with a review of radiographic images, and the penetration of the pedicle cortex by postoperative CT scans.\u0000\u0000\u0000RESULTS\u0000Under the guidance of CT-based navigation 102 screws were inserted. Cobb's angle was corrected to an average of 15 degrees in the 14 patients. The sagittal screw angle was less than 10 degrees for 92 (90.2 %) screws, and the overall average was 5 degrees. The results of the postoperative CT review showed only 3 (2.9 %) screws penetrated the pedicle cortex laterally and no screw penetrated medially. No iagtrogenic neurological injury was found.\u0000\u0000\u0000CONCLUSION\u0000The accuracy of pedicle screw placement is crucial for thoracolumbar spine fracture fixation. The placement of pedicle screws can be done accurately with the aid of a CT-based image-guided system. Complications of cement-augmented dynamic hip screws in unstable type intertrochanteric fractures--a case series study. 骨水泥增强动力髋螺钉治疗不稳定型转子间骨折的并发症——一个病例系列研究。
Chang Gung medical journal Pub Date : 2012-07-01 DOI: 10.4103/2319-4170.106135
Meng-Huang Wu, Po-Cheng Lee, Kuo-Ti Peng, Chi-Chuan Wu, Tsung-Jen Huang, Robert Wen-Wei Hsu
{"title":"Complications of cement-augmented dynamic hip screws in unstable type intertrochanteric fractures--a case series study.","authors":"Meng-Huang Wu,&nbsp;Po-Cheng Lee,&nbsp;Kuo-Ti Peng,&nbsp;Chi-Chuan Wu,&nbsp;Tsung-Jen Huang,&nbsp;Robert Wen-Wei Hsu","doi":"10.4103/2319-4170.106135","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.4103/2319-4170.106135","url":null,"abstract":"<p><strong>Background: </strong>Polymethylmethacrylate (PMMA) cement-augmented dynamic hip screws (DHS) have been used as a solution in unstable intertrochanteric fractures (ITF). Our aim was to investigate the complications in PMMA cement-augmented DHS.</p><p><strong>Methods: </strong>All patients who had received DHS plate osteosynthesis with or without PMMA cement augmentation from August 2005 to July 2009 in one medical center were retrospectively reviewed. The fractures were classified as unstable (31-A2.2, 31-A2.3 and 31-A3) on the basis of the Arbeitsgemeinschaft für Osteosynthesefragen classification. Inclusion criteria were patients older than 75 years, unstable ITF treated with cement-augmented DHS, and a minimum of 12 months of follow-up. Exclusion criteria were stable ITFs, incomplete chart records and imaging studies, loss to follow-up or death before bone union.</p><p><strong>Results: </strong>Three hundred twenty-one patients received DHS during the study period. Sixty-seven patients were included in the study (25 men and 42 women; mean age, 81.2 years). The mean follow-up time was 40.2 months, and the mean union time was 18.5 weeks (12-40 weeks). No patient had a lag screw cut-out. Six patients had delayed union or nonunion with side plate failures, including side plate breakage in 1 patient, screw breakage in 3, screw pullout in 1, and recurrent side plate breakage and screw breakage in 1. Deep infection occurred in 1 patient, and 1 had osteonecrosis at the femoral head. The procedure-related complication rate was 8.9%.</p><p><strong>Conclusions: </strong>Cement-augmented DHS have a different failure mode than screw cutout in conventional DHS. Correlation of anaplastic lymphoma kinase overexpression and the EML4-ALK fusion gene in non-small cell lung cancer by immunohistochemical study. 免疫组化研究非小细胞肺癌间变性淋巴瘤激酶过表达与EML4-ALK融合基因的相关性
Chang Gung medical journal Pub Date : 2012-07-01 DOI: 10.4103/2319-4170.106140
Tai-Di Chen, Il-Chi Chang, Hui-Ping Liu, Yi-Cheng Wu, Chi-Liang Wang, Ya-Ting Chen, Yi-Rong Chen, Shiu-Feng Huang
{"title":"Correlation of anaplastic lymphoma kinase overexpression and the EML4-ALK fusion gene in non-small cell lung cancer by immunohistochemical study.","authors":"Tai-Di Chen,&nbsp;Il-Chi Chang,&nbsp;Hui-Ping Liu,&nbsp;Yi-Cheng Wu,&nbsp;Chi-Liang Wang,&nbsp;Ya-Ting Chen,&nbsp;Yi-Rong Chen,&nbsp;Shiu-Feng Huang","doi":"10.4103/2319-4170.106140","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.4103/2319-4170.106140","url":null,"abstract":"<p><strong>Background: </strong>Recently the echinoderm microtubule-associated protein-like 4-anaplastic lymphoma kinase (EML4-ALK) fusion gene with transforming activity was identified in non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C). In addition, NSCLC patients with the EML4-ALK fusion gene had a dramatic response and longer progression free survival after ALK inhibitor treatment than those without this fusion gene. However, the incidence and clinical and molecular characteristics of the EML4-ALK fusion gene in NSCLC patients of Taiwan are still unclear.</p><p><strong>Methods: </strong>Sixty-four fresh frozen tumor specimens were obtained from the tissue bank of Chang Gung Memorial Hospital for RNA extraction and EML4-ALK fusion gene detection. Paraffin sections of lung tumors from all of these patients were available and were analyzed for ALK protein expression by immunohistochemical (IHC) study. The results were correlated with clinical and molecular biomarkers.</p><p><strong>Results: </strong>Three of the 64 tumors (4.7%) had the EML4-ALK fusion gene. Two were adenocarcinomas, and one was adenosquamous carcinoma. Twenty patients with non-squamous cell carcinomas had ep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R) mutations, so the EML4-ALK fusion gene was found in 14.3% of EGFR wild type non-squamous cell carcinomas. Two tumors were variant 3 (3a+3b with 3b predominant) and had strong staining (3+) for ALK by IHC stains. One tumor was variant 1 and had moderate staining (2+) for ALK. None of the ALK wild type tumors had strong staining for ALK. Temporary vesicostomy-assisted urethroplasty for recurrent obliterated posterior urethral stricture. 暂时性膀胱造口辅助尿道成形术治疗复发性闭塞性后尿道狭窄。
Chang Gung medical journal Pub Date : 2012-07-01 DOI: 10.4103/2319-4170.106136
Jui-Ming Liu, Ta-Min Wang, Yang-Jen Chiang, Hsiao-Wen Chen, Sheng-Hsien Chu, Kuan-Lin Liu, Kuo-Jen Lin
{"title":"Temporary vesicostomy-assisted urethroplasty for recurrent obliterated posterior urethral stricture.","authors":"Jui-Ming Liu,&nbsp;Ta-Min Wang,&nbsp;Yang-Jen Chiang,&nbsp;Hsiao-Wen Chen,&nbsp;Sheng-Hsien Chu,&nbsp;Kuan-Lin Liu,&nbsp;Kuo-Jen Lin","doi":"10.4103/2319-4170.106136","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.4103/2319-4170.106136","url":null,"abstract":"<p><strong>Background: </strong>We report the outcomes of temporary vesicostomy- assisted anastomotic urethroplasty in patients with recurrent obliterated posterior urethral stricture.</p><p><strong>Methods: </strong>A review of the medical records identified 12 men (mean age 35.8 years) who had undergone anastomotic urethroplasty for recurrent obliterated posterior stricture. Preoperative evaluation of the urethral defect included a simultaneous retrograde urethrogram and cystogram. The mean estimated preoperative radiographic length of the urethral disruption was 4.25 cm. All patients underwent 1-stage bulboprostatic anastomotic repair which was assisted by an intraoperative temporary vesicostomy.</p><p><strong>Results: </strong>The initial objective success rate was 83%. The mean follow-up was 22 months. Voiding cystourethrography performed postoperatively demonstrated a wide, patent anastomosis in all but two cases. Urethroscopy performed 1 month after surgery revealed a patent anastomosis with normal urethral mucosa in all but two patients. The mean peak flow rate at the last follow-up visit was 16.3 ml/s. Two patients developed an anastomotic stricture 6 weeks after surgery that was successfully treated by direct visual internal urethrotomy. Human papillomavirus research on the prevention, diagnosis, and prognosis of cervical cancer in Taiwan. 台湾人乳头瘤病毒对子宫颈癌预防、诊断及预后的研究。
Chang Gung medical journal Pub Date : 2012-07-01 DOI: 10.4103/2319-4170.106141
Angel Chao, Huei-Jean Huang, Chyong-Huey Lai
{"title":"Human papillomavirus research on the prevention, diagnosis, and prognosis of cervical cancer in Taiwan.","authors":"Angel Chao,&nbsp;Huei-Jean Huang,&nbsp;Chyong-Huey Lai","doi":"10.4103/2319-4170.106141","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.4103/2319-4170.106141","url":null,"abstract":"<p><p>Cervical cancer is third in incidence and fourth in mortality among cancers of women worldwide. Epidemiological studies have shown that human papillomavirus (HPV) is necessary, if not sufficient, to cause nearly 100% of cervical cancers. HPV testing is useful in primary screening for cervical neoplasms. The value of HPV detection or genotyping is potentially useful in triage of borderline or low-grade abnormal cervical cytology, follow-up after treatment of cervical intraepithelial neoplasia, assessment of prognosis and treatment planning for invasive cervical cancer. Studies from Chang Gung Memorial Hospital have defined the genotype distribution of cervical cancer in Taiwan and confirmed the independent prognostic value of the HPV genotype in cervical cancer. The cost-effectiveness of using HPV testing in prevention and management of cervical neoplasms depends on the medical and public health infrastructure of the individual country. The population-based HPV prevalence and genotype distribution as well as longitudinal follow-up studies have established strong support for incorporating HPV testing with cervical cytology and for future comparisons of HPV epidemiology before and after implementation of HPV prophylactic vaccines in Taiwan. Comparison of central corneal thickness measurements by ultrasonic pachymetry, Orbscan II, and SP3000P in eyes with glaucoma or glaucoma suspect. 青光眼和疑似青光眼超声测厚仪、Orbscan II和SP3000P测量角膜中央厚度的比较
Chang Gung medical journal Pub Date : 2012-05-01 DOI: 10.4103/2319-4170.106146
Tsung-Ho Ou, Ing-Chou Lai, Mei-Ching Teng
{"title":"Comparison of central corneal thickness measurements by ultrasonic pachymetry, Orbscan II, and SP3000P in eyes with glaucoma or glaucoma suspect.","authors":"Tsung-Ho Ou,&nbsp;Ing-Chou Lai,&nbsp;Mei-Ching Teng","doi":"10.4103/2319-4170.106146","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.4103/2319-4170.106146","url":null,"abstract":"<p><strong>Background: </strong>Intraocular pressure (IOP) measurements are affected by the central cornea thickness (CCT). The conventional method for CCT measurement is ultrasonic pachymetry. However, noncontact procedures lower the risk of infection and corneal damage. In this study, we compared the CCT measured by Orbscan II, SP3000P, and ultrasonic pachymetry in patients with glaucoma or glaucoma suspect.</p><p><strong>Methods: </strong>The CCT of 208 eyes (46 eyes with glaucoma suspect, 42 with primary angle-closure glaucoma, and 120 with primary open-angle glaucoma) was measured using Orbscan II, SP3000P, and ultrasonic pachymetry. We compared the linear correlation of the CCT between each mode.</p><p><strong>Results: </strong>The mean CCT measured by Orbscan II (563.63 ± 35.867 µm) was larger than with the other two devices. There were significant linear correlations between measurements with ultrasonic pachymetry and Orbscan II (Pearson correlation coefficient (r) = 0.793, p < 0.001), ultrasonic pachymetry and SP3000P (r = 0.890, p < 0.001), and Orbscan II and SP3000P (r = 0.803, p < 0.001). We divided the participants into 3 groups on the basis of the CCT measured with ultrasonic pachymetry: ≤ 500 µm, > 500 µm to ≤ 578 µm, and > 578 µm. There was no significant linear correlation between ultrasonic pachymetry and Orbscan II in the thin group. But, in the intermediate and thick CCT groups, there were significant linear correlations between each of the three devices.</p><p><strong>Conclusion: </strong>We showed good linear correlations of CCT measurements between each of 3 devices, especially in the intermediate and thickest CCTs. Classification and analysis of pathology of the long head of the biceps tendon in complete rotator cuff tears. 完全性肩袖撕裂二头肌肌腱长头的分类与病理分析。
Chang Gung medical journal Pub Date : 2012-05-01 DOI: 10.4103/2319-4170.106145
Chien-Hao Chen, Chih-Hwa Chen, Chih-Hsiang Chang, Chun-I Su, Kun-Chung Wang, I-Chun Wang, Hsien-Tao Liu, Chung-Ming Yu, Kuo-Yao Hsu
{"title":"Classification and analysis of pathology of the long head of the biceps tendon in complete rotator cuff tears.","authors":"Chien-Hao Chen,&nbsp;Chih-Hwa Chen,&nbsp;Chih-Hsiang Chang,&nbsp;Chun-I Su,&nbsp;Kun-Chung Wang,&nbsp;I-Chun Wang,&nbsp;Hsien-Tao Liu,&nbsp;Chung-Ming Yu,&nbsp;Kuo-Yao Hsu","doi":"10.4103/2319-4170.106145","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.4103/2319-4170.106145","url":null,"abstract":"<p><strong>Background: </strong>Pathology of the long head of the biceps tendon (LHB) is commonly associated with rotator cuff tears (RCTs). Superior labral anterior-posterior (SLAP) lesions can also occur with RCTs. The purpose of this study was to include SLAP lesions as part of LHB pathology in surgical cases of RCT and define the role of SLAP lesions in RCTs.</p><p><strong>Methods: </strong>We retrospectively evaluated clinical data from 176 cases of complete RCT undergoing surgery. During surgery, the LHB was arthroscopically examined. A modified 6-type classification was used to describe the LHB pathology in these cases: tendinitis, subluxation, dislocation, partial tear, complete rupture and SLAP lesions. The relationship of LHB pathology to different characteristics of RCTs was statistically analyzed.</p><p><strong>Results: </strong>Of RCT cases, 33% had Type 1 (tendinitis), 11% had Type 2 (subluxation), 9% had Type 3 (dislocation), 16% had Type 4 (partial tear), 7% had Type 5 (complete rupture) and 6% had Type 6 (SLAP) lesions. The remaining 18% of cases had no obvious LHB pathology. LHB pathology were associated with RCTs of a long duration (> 3 months), large area (> 5 cm(2)), and multiple or subscapularis tendon involvement. Seventy four percent of patients with affected shoulders underwent simultaneous surgery for both LHB pathology and RCTs.</p><p><strong>Conclusion: </strong>Most patient with RCTs with chronic, massive, and multiple or subscapularis tendon involvement also had LHB injury. Clinical utility of histological examination of gastric ulcer margin to diagnose Helicobacter pylori infection. 胃溃疡边缘组织学检查诊断幽门螺杆菌感染的临床应用。
Chang Gung medical journal Pub Date : 2012-05-01 DOI: 10.4103/2319-4170.106148
Mu-Shien Lee, Chi-Ju Yeh, Hsing-Yu Chen, Yung-Kuan Tsou, Cheng-Hui Lin, Jau-Min Lien
{"title":"Clinical utility of histological examination of gastric ulcer margin to diagnose Helicobacter pylori infection.","authors":"Mu-Shien Lee,&nbsp;Chi-Ju Yeh,&nbsp;Hsing-Yu Chen,&nbsp;Yung-Kuan Tsou,&nbsp;Cheng-Hui Lin,&nbsp;Jau-Min Lien","doi":"10.4103/2319-4170.106148","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.4103/2319-4170.106148","url":null,"abstract":"<p><strong>Background: </strong>To investigate the effectiveness of histological examination of ulcer margins (HEUM) in detecting Helicobacter pylori (H. pylori) infection in patients with non-bleeding gastric ulcers (GUs).</p><p><strong>Methods: </strong>A retrospective study included 284 patients with GU undergoing concomitant HEUM and rapid urease test (RUT) to detect H. pylori infection between January 2005 and December 2006. The slides were reviewed by an experienced pathologist (revised HEUM) in the 52 patients with inconsistent results on the initial HEUM and RUT. H. pylori infection was defined as a postive RUT and/or revised HEUM. Detection rates of H. pylori infection for HEUM and RUT were calculated accordingly. In patients with H. pylori infection, several parameters including ulcer characteristics and pathological findings were compared between patients with negative and positive (revised) HEUM.</p><p><strong>Results: </strong>A total of 164 (57.7%) patients had positive results of H. pylori infection. The overall detection rates of H. pylori infection on the initial HEUM, revised HEUM and RUT were 78.0% (128/164), 89.0% (146/164), and 94.5% (155/164), respectively. For antrum ulcers, the respective detection rates were 81.0% (85/105), 92.4% (97/105), and 93.3% (98/105), for angulus ulcers, 78.6% (22/28), 85.7% (24/28), and 100% (28/28), and for proximal stomach ulcers, 61.9% (13/21), 81.0% (17/21), and 90.4% (19/21). In patients with H. pylori infection, gastric malignancy was more frequently observed in patients with false negative than true positive HEUMs.</p><p><strong>Conclusions: </strong>HEUM might be not sensitive enough for diagnosing H. pylori in patients with GU.
